How does one claim that credit if there is a drop in fare for the same class of service on the same flight after one has booked and paid the higher fare? UA has its "lowest fare guarantee," but the LFG does not pertain to this. And for the LFG, which is supposed to refund you the difference between what you paid through united.com and what you could find elsewhere on the internet plus a $50 cert, you must find the lower fare and make your claim that same day.
